5.3.2 Self-assessment for Strategic Leadership

This section contains the self-assessment questionnaire for Strategic Leadership. The questionnaire asks a number of questions to ascertain:

'how the SMT have applied their management and support to harmonise and align the institutional and ICT strategies, organisation, governance and performance?'

Answer the questions for the 'domain' that you are analysing e.g. Institution, Business Services Strongly Disagree Disagree Don't Know or N/A Agree Strongly Agree Evidence for your response
1 Your Senior Management Team (SMT) communicate effectively with institutional committees regarding ICT issues?           See section 2.7.2 within the toolkit knowledge base for help regarding this question.
2 The Senior Management Team (SMT) includes a Chief Information Officer (CIO), or equivalent senior ICT professional amongst its membership?           See section 2.4.7 within the toolkit knowledge base for help regarding this question.
3 The Senior Management Team (SMT) includes at least one member who combines a deep understanding of communication and information technology with senior management experience.           See section 2.5.2 within the toolkit knowledge base for help regarding this question.
4 The ICT Strategy Group, or equivalent group, includes a member of the Senior Management Team (SMT).              See section 2.6 within the toolkit knowledge base for help regarding this question.
5 The Senior Management Team (SMT) are able to communicate the ICT governance structure effectively to everyone involved in managing ICT related teams including both key service providers and key users.            See section 2.6.2 within the toolkit knowledge base for help regarding this question.
6 The Senior Management Team (SMT) promotes the importance and value of ICT governance.           See section 2.6 within the toolkit knowledge base for help regarding this question.
7 A Chief Information Officer (CIO), or equivalent senior ICT manager, is actively involved in supporting the Senior Management Team (SMT) during institutional & ICT strategic planning.           See section 2.4.7 within the toolkit knowledge base for help regarding this question.
8 A Chief Information Officer (CIO), or equivalent senior role, champions the consideration of relevant new technologies within strategic planning.           See section 2.4.7 within the toolkit knowledge base for help regarding this question.
9 A Chief Information Officer (CIO), or equivalent senior ICT manager, regularly communicates with senior institutional management.           See section 2.4.7 within the toolkit knowledge base for help regarding this question.
10 The senior management team clearly understand their role and responsibilities in the planning of new solutions involving ICT.           See section 2.4.9 within the toolkit knowledge base for help regarding this question.
